Tentative Ruling: Francisco Bueno vs City of Santa Barbara

Case Number

25CV05699

Case Type

Civil Law & Motion

Hearing Date / Time

Fri, 06/12/2026 - 10:00

Nature of Proceedings

CMC; Motion for Leave

Tentative Ruling

On September 11, 2025, plaintiff Francisco Bueno filed the original complaint in this action against defendants City of Santa Barbara (City) and County of Santa Barbara (County). On November 3, 2025, City filed its answer to the complaint generally denying the allegations thereof and asserting 16 affirmative defenses. On December 12, 2025, Bueno requested, and the court entered, dismissal as to County. On January 15, 2026, Bueno filed two “Doe” amendments identifying defendants Cox Communications California LLC, and Frontier Communications Corporate Services, Inc., as Does 1 and 2, respectively. On March 27, 2026, Bueno filed this motion for leave to file a first amended complaint (FAC). On May 27, 2026, Bueno filed an errata to the motion for leave to correct the name of the Frontier entity defendant. No opposition or other response has been filed to the motion.

The motion for leave to file a FAC is granted. Bueno shall file and serve the FAC, in substantially the same form as attached to the errata to the motion, on or before June 22, 2026.
